AN Ebbw Vale man was found guilty of stealing £16,500 from a fund set up to help his son fight a degenerative disease.

It took a jury at Cardiff Crown Court just half an hour this morning to find Julian Emms, 46, of Southbank, Beaufort, guilty of fraud by abuse of position.

Emms stole the money from the Michael Emms Fund- set up in 2007 to fund treatment for Emms' 20-year-old son Michael, who had motor neurone disease.

While Michael died on April 11 2011, aged 23, £16,500 was taken out of the fund by Emms in August 2010.

Emms was released on bail and will be sentenced on March 16.
